From: Comparison of real-time PCR and microscopy for malaria parasite detection in Malawian pregnant women
Enrollment, second trimester: | n = 475 |
---|---|
Age (years; mean, SD) | 24 (6.3) |
BMI (mean, SD) | 21.9 (2.2) |
Gravidity: | Â |
   Primigravidae (%) | 28.6 |
   Secundigravidae (%) | 17.9 |
   Multigravidae (%) | 53.5 |
Bed net use by mother in enrollment (%) | 60 |
HIV infection (%) | 12.4 |
Delivery: | Â |
Maternal haemoglobin (g/dL; mean, SD) | 11.4 (1.9)* |
Maternal anaemia** (%) | 31.3* |
Maternal microscopy result for malaria***: | Â |
   P. falciparum (%) | 2.3 |
P. vivax (%) | 0 |
P. ovale (%) | 0 |
P. malariae (%) | 0.6 |
Season of birth: | Â |
   Jan - March (%) | 16.8 |
   April - June (%) | 29.9 |
July - Sept (%) | 31.2 |
Oct - Dec (%) | 22.1 |
Estimated gestational age of the child (weeks; mean, SD) | 38.8 (1.8) |
